Tortellini with bacon and greens

Serves 4Hands-On Time: 15mTotal Time: 30m

Ingredients

  • 1  pound  cheese or meat tortellini
  • 4  ounces  sliced bacon (i use turkey bacon)
  • 6  tablespoons  unsalted butter
  • 2  cups  arugula (about 1 bunch) or I bet this would work well with spinach
  • 1/4  teaspoon  kosher salt
  • 1/4  teaspoon  black pepper

Directions

  1. Cook the tortellini according to the package directions.
  2. Meanwhile, cook the bacon in a large skillet over medium heat until crisp, 7 to 8 minutes. Reserve the bacon and discard the drippings.
  3. Wipe out the skillet and return it to medium heat. Add the butter and swirl or stir with a wooden spoon as it starts to foam and sputter. Remove from heat as soon as it begins to turn golden brown and smells nutty, about 1 minute.
  4. Break the bacon into small pieces and add to the skillet with the arugula, salt, pepper, and cooked tortellini; toss well. Divide among individual bowls.
